WebSep 29, 2024 · 1. Take stock of your parts. As a reminder, to build a gaming PC, you'll need (at minimum) a motherboard, a CPU, a GPU, some RAM, a storage device, a power supply and a case. As we predicted in ... Webgocphim.net

WebJun 10, 2024 · Optimize shaders. Give each renderer a material. This’ll save resources in the beginning since the game doesn’t have to create new materials for everything. Have the shader for the material only include what’s functionally needed (for example, a button that doesn’t need masking can use a Sprite shader instead). Superior performance for the price (especially for gaming PCs) “Performance for the price” is another way of saying “bang for your buck.”. When you pay the same amount of money, but you get much better performance, then you are getting higher performance/price.
